英文摘要
In high-performance concrete, a delay in setting may result with the addition of large amounts of superplasticizer, viscosity agent, and other admixtures. To solve this problem, a setting accelerator is used, which traditionally used to be calcium chloride (CaCl_2). However, calcium chloride is not used currently because it leads to corrosion of steel reinforcements. In the present study, we have developed non-chloride compound setting accelerator, in which aluminum sulfate (Al_2(SO_4)_3) and barium nitrate (Ba(NO_3)_2) are the main components instead of calcium chloride. The effects of these additives on setting property, flow property, and compressive strength were investigated when industrial byproducts such as fly-ash and blast-furnace slag were used in the high-flow concrete. The setting time was found to be shortened by about 30-40% while maintaining a similar flow property to concrete without a setting accelerator. The performance was increased by about 15% compared with that of the calcium nitrite accelerator which is presently used.
